This So-Called Dollar is given the catalog number HK-873f

The obverse text on this So-Called Dollar reads Monetary Unity World Peace, United Nations, Essai Ducaton 1946 and the reverse text is Freedom, Religion, Want, Speech, Fear. The front side of the coin shows the flags of the United States, U.S.S.R., China, England and France spread through the center of the coin with dates and lines of text below, two lines of text above the illustration in the center. The backside of the coin depicts the left, right, top, and bottom of the coin filled with illustrations of women doing various activities, text in the center and surrounding.
